Transaction e5876b94f0656e8f974acb1342226ffd06a74c6fe3b4ea25ea9817aaf67d0594
1 Input
1 Output
-
e5876b94f0656e8f974acb1342226ffd06a74c6fe3b4ea25ea9817aaf67d0594:0
- value
- 315821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ec94fadd0ac95cadfa090775531a2646daca7ae OP_EQUAL
- address
- 3BnoQzhjXrpsTMP4PVjM8zusmPWNrk7RcN